Cristiano Ronaldo buys most expensive mansion in Portugal

By Adeleye Kunle
Cristiano Ronaldo has purchased the most expensive house in Portugal for £18m.
This is following his rumoured links to a return to Sporting CP.
The money also includes renovating the property to the player’s taste. The house is expected to be ready by 2023.
The mansion is said to be sitting in the Cascais region of Portugal and has an area of 2,720 square meters across three floors.
It also has an outdoor area of 544 square meters with various gardens and a large swimming pool.
Ronaldo has managed only three goals and one assist in 13 games across all competitions this season majorly due to a lack of playing time under Erik ten Hag who prefers Marcus Rashford upfront
